Break-Glass Access: Coldwell Archive Buckets

Release managers may invoke break-glass access when routine credentials for the cold storage archiving pipeline are unavailable and an archive restore is time-critical. Every invocation is logged, reviewed at the next ops sync, and triggers automatic credential rotation within 24 hours. Confirm with a second on-call engineer before proceeding. At the emergency console prompt, enter the break-glass recovery passphrase exactly as written here.

unlock words, hahip-baduf: holwyn-istath-julvan

## Configuration: Per-Tenant Rate Quotas

Hey support folks — Meterline enforces per-tenant quotas so one noisy customer can't starve everyone else. Defaults live in `quotas.default.toml`, but tenant overrides come from the admin panel, so you usually don't need to touch files. If a tenant complains about 429s, check their tier first before escalating. For the quota service to talk to the tenant registry, the env file needs the signing credential set. Right below this paragraph, your env file should contain this line:

sealed setting: ARCHIVE_KEY3=8d0

- [ ] Step 7: Archive cold storage buckets (Glacierline tier). Confirm both ceremony witnesses are present, verify bucket manifests match the Oxbow ledger, then seal the archive key shares. Plugin authors may observe but not handle shares. Once sealed, the archive index itself is encrypted and can only be reopened with the passphrase below.

vault phrase of badup-hahig = tamael-aldael-kelmir-istael-fenok-istwyn-tamius-jorath-oliion